Putative neural circuits underlying behavior. Brain regions involved in prey capture and exploratory behavior: PSm, magnocellular superficial pretectal nucleus; AF7, arborization field 7; RGC, retinal ganglion cells; nMLF, nucleus of the medial longitudinal fascicle; OT, optic tectum; NI, nucleus isthmi; ARTR, anterior rhombencephalic turning region; cH, caudal hypothalamus; LH, lateral hypothalamus. The arrows indicate the interactions between the different brain regions. |
